Sakuraba Meets Another Gracie At DREAM.14

DREAM today added two more bouts to the May 29 DREAM.14 event. The card will be held at the Saitama Super Arena in Japan, the home of many legendary moments from the now-defunct PRIDE organization.

The Japanese promotion announced that Kazushi Sakuraba will be taking on Ralek Gracie in a 195-pound catchweight bout. Gracie, 24, is the son of Rorion Gracie, who founded the UFC in 1992, and the nephew of Royce Gracie. His last appearance in an MMA bout took place in June 2008, where he defeated Alavutdin Gadzhiyev in typical Gracie style via submission.

Sakuraba’s legendary wars with the Gracie family helped create a mixed martial arts boom in Japan earlier in the decade. He first defeated Royler Gracie at PRIDE 8 in 1999, winning via kimura. Sakuraba would go on to face Royce, Renzo and Ryan, going undefeated in competition with the Gracies and earning the nickname “The Gracie Hunter.”

Sakuraba’s best days are behind him, but he’s racked up a two-fight win streak since his last lost to Kiyoshi Tamura in 2008.

The Sakuraba/Gracie bout is expected to headline DREAM.14, but the card also features Nick Diaz taking on Hayato Sakurai and Joachim Hansen vs. Hiroyuki Takaya.
